New URL for NEMO forge!   http://forge.nemo-ocean.eu

Since March 2022 along with NEMO 4.2 release, the code development moved to a self-hosted GitLab.
This present forge is now archived and remained online for history.
Changeset 8954 for branches/UKMO/dev_r4650_general_vert_coord_obsoper_logchl_std/NEMOGCM/NEMO/OPA_SRC/OBS/obs_write.F90 – NEMO

Ignore:
Timestamp:
2017-12-08T12:32:59+01:00 (6 years ago)
Author:
dford
Message:

Import changes from reanalysis branch.

File:
1 edited

Legend:

Unmodified
Added
Removed
  • branches/UKMO/dev_r4650_general_vert_coord_obsoper_logchl_std/NEMOGCM/NEMO/OPA_SRC/OBS/obs_write.F90

    r7713 r8954  
    974974         nadd = padd%inum 
    975975      ELSE 
    976          nadd = 0 
     976         nadd = 1 
    977977      ENDIF 
    978978 
     
    10001000      fbdata%caddunit(1,1) = 'mg/m3' 
    10011001      fbdata%cgrid(1)      = 'T' 
    1002       DO ja = 1, nadd 
    1003          fbdata%caddname(1+ja) = padd%cdname(ja) 
    1004          fbdata%caddlong(1+ja,1) = padd%cdlong(ja,1) 
    1005          fbdata%caddunit(1+ja,1) = padd%cdunit(ja,1) 
    1006       END DO 
     1002      IF ( PRESENT( padd ) ) THEN 
     1003         DO ja = 1, nadd 
     1004            fbdata%caddname(1+ja) = padd%cdname(ja) 
     1005            fbdata%caddlong(1+ja,1) = padd%cdlong(ja,1) 
     1006            fbdata%caddunit(1+ja,1) = padd%cdunit(ja,1) 
     1007         END DO 
     1008      ELSE 
     1009         fbdata%caddname(2) = 'STD' 
     1010         fbdata%caddlong(2) = 'Standard deviation of LOGCHL' 
     1011         fbdata%caddunit(2) = 'mg/m3' 
     1012      ENDIF 
    10071013 
    10081014      WRITE(cfname, FMT="(A,'_fdbk_',I4.4,'.nc')") TRIM(cprefix), nproc 
     
    10671073         fbdata%iobsk(1,jo,1)  = 0 
    10681074         DO ja = 1, nadd 
    1069             fbdata%padd(1,jo,1+ja,1) = & 
    1070                & logchldata%rext(jo,padd%ipoint(ja)) 
     1075            IF ( PRESENT( padd ) ) THEN 
     1076               fbdata%padd(1,jo,1+ja,1) = & 
     1077                  & logchldata%rext(jo,padd%ipoint(ja)) 
     1078            ELSE 
     1079               fbdata%padd(1,jo,1+ja,1) = & 
     1080                  & logchldata%rext(jo,1) 
     1081            ENDIF 
    10711082         END DO 
    10721083         DO je = 1, next 
Note: See TracChangeset for help on using the changeset viewer.